I don't mean to bump an old thread but since the last post was made here the POTC line was released and we saw most of these suggestions used between the POTC line and the newest castle line. Would it be possible for us to start working on another one of these requests since the first one got such a good response? Here is a list of some of my suggestions.

1. In the next line of pirates the imperial soldiers should have more torsos for the officers and maybe stripes on their arms showing rank. example My link
2.Swivel guns and mortars
3.Include some common sailors on the imperial ships instead of just the captain and imperial soldiers
4.More civilians
5.Star wars theme has exclusive sets every year. How about an exclusive ship released every year for the pirate theme. Example 2012:Spanish Galleon. 2013:British Frigate. 2014:Dutch Fluyt. They don't even have to be nationality specific they could just release a galleon or frigate with generic looks and minifigs.
6.Bring back accessory packs
7.Release more battle packs like the castle theme has had the last couple years
8.Bayonets that can attach to the current guns
9.drum that attaches to the minifig like the backpack and hangs in front of the minifig maybe this could be introduced in the form of a high school band drummer in the collectible minifig series or it could be put on a new imperial ship to represent some one beating to quarters example drummer example
10.Introduce some new hats like these example1example2example3example4
11.More different colored Imperial soldiers instead of just the red and blue coats how about green,yellow,and white coats.
